Greg in 'Huffington Post' on What's at Stake for 鶹ýIOS' Rights in Eleventh Circuit Case
In his newest article for The Huffington Post, Greg details the latest legal developments in Barnes v. Zaccari and reviews the impressive list of organizations who have joined 鶹ýIOS in filing an amicus brief with the United States Court of Appeals for the Eleventh Circuit.
